Abstract

The success of a volleyball game is supported by the ability of its players to master various basic volleyball techniques. Top passing is one of the basic techniques in volleyball that students must have. The problem in this study is that the level of volleyball upper passing ability at SMK Negeri 1 Martapura is unknown. This study aims to determine the level of volleyball upper passing ability in students of SMK Negeri 1 Martapura. The variable in this study is a single variable, namely the ability to pass over volleyball. The population in this study were X TKJ 1 class students totaling 36 students, while the sample was taken using total sampling technique so that all populations were sampled in this study. The method in this research is descriptive quantitative with a survey approach. Data collection techniques using the upper passing test instrument. Data analysis using the Percentage Formula. The results showed that the level of upper passing ability in class X TKJ 1 students showed that students who had a good category were 17 students (47%), who had a sufficient category of 13 students (36%), who had a category of less than 6 students (10%). The results show that SMK Negeri 1 Martapura students have a fairly good upper passing ability based on the results that get a good category as much as 47% of the total sampling.
